Smith departs Risk for Bloomberg

Robert Mackenzie Smith

Robert Mackenzie Smith has joined Bloomberg as a financial market structure research analyst, under Larry Tab, head of market structure research, Bloomberg Intelligence.

Recently, Smith was U.S. markets editor at Risk Magazine, Infopro Digital. He  spent more than five years with the company, joining as a staff writer.

He then served as a senior staff writer and then as U.S. asset management editor.

Smith was also a reporter and senior reporter at FX Week and a financial adviser at NatWest.

Smith is a B.A. from the University of Bristol and holds a diploma in journalism from the London School of Journalism.
